§911. Additional salary of district attorney

A.The district attorney of the Fortieth Judicial District shall receive, in addition to the salary paid by the state, an annual salary of four thousand eight hundred fifty dollars, payable monthly on his own warrant by the governing authority of the parish of St. John the Baptist.
B.The governing authority of the parish of St. John the Baptist shall annually budget an amount sufficient to pay the salary fixed in Subsection A of this Section.

Legislative History

Added by Acts 1982, No. 21, §6(f), eff. Jan. 1, 1985, subject to approval of electors.
